What We're Building#
OpenIAP is transitioning from a single-maintainer library to an open interoperability standard with neutral governance. We need organizations who understand why this matters:
- A common specification for purchase types, error codes, and verification across iOS, Android, and emerging platforms
- Generated, type-safe bindings for TypeScript, Swift, Kotlin, Dart, C#, and GDScript
- Security-first design with verification profiles and fraud prevention patterns
- Open governance so no single company controls the purchase interoperability layer
